I am confused about a few references I have read regarding experience loss from replacements (Using 3.0). There is a mention in the manual that units lose 5xp per step when taking reinforcements, then another section talks about a 'discount' for the first two steps not causing XP loss. Then I also saw something about the discount only applying in the home country (core area).

So for example, after I invade Poland, if I have units who are damaged to an '8', and I pay to replace them back to 10, do I lose 10xp? Do I have to move them back to original German territory, and then I can replace them to a 10 without XP loss?

Re: Replacement Experience question

Posted: Sat Apr 05, 2014 1:16 am
by Peter Stauffenberg
It's the latter. In GS v3.01 you can replace from 7 strength without losing XP.
